Corporate & Cross‑Border
Commercial Law
Structure your business, protect your investments, and trade with confidence.
Whether you are setting up a new company, expanding from the UK into Nigeria, or managing cross‑border trade and partnerships, you need legal advice that works in both jurisdictions. We help you build solid legal foundations, negotiate fair terms, and reduce risk at every stage.
Our approach is commercial and practical — we focus on solutions that protect your interests while keeping your business moving forward.
WHAT WE COVER
Company Formation & Governance – Incorporation, shareholder agreements, board structures, and ongoing compliance
Cross‑Border Investment & Trade – Guidance for UK‑Nigeria trade, joint ventures, and foreign direct investment
Fintech & Technology – Licensing, intellectual property, software agreements, and data protection under the NDPA
Trade & Logistics – Drafting contracts, advising on customs rules, and resolving cross‑border disputes
Multinational Operations – Expatriate quotas, business permits, employment contracts, and local compliance for foreign subsidiaries

Operating across the UK‑Nigeria corridor means navigating complex, evolving rules. We help you stay fully authorised, avoid fines, and maintain good standing with all key regulators.
WHAT WE COVER
Corporate & Investment Regulation – CAC, NIPC, SEC, FIRS
Financial & Fintech Compliance – CBN, NDPC, NCC
Energy & Sector Regulation – PIA, Electricity Act; licensing via NERC, NUPRC, FM of Power; EIA, gas monetisation, flare reduction, and regulatory liaison
Sector Licensing & Permits – Applications, renewals, compliance audits
Regulatory Liaison – Engaging authorities to resolve queries and secure approvals
